The Science Behind Sativa and Indica

Within the realm of cannabis, two primary classifications often dominate the conversation: sativa and indica. These distinction isn't simply a matter of preference; it delves into the fascinating world of phytochemistry and how different cannabinoid profiles affect our experiences. While traditional understandings often paint sativas as energizing and indicas as relaxing, the science is complex.

Sativa strains are typically associated with higher levels of THC, the primary psychoactive compound in cannabis. This often produces a cerebral high characterized by feelings of euphoria, along with improved focus. Conversely, indicas are often thought to have larger amounts of CBD, a non-psychoactive compound known for its calming and therapeutic properties. This commonly leads to a more body-focused high, perfect for unwinding after a long day or reducing tension.

Exploring Cannabis Types: Sativa, Indica, and Hybrids

The cannabis world is buzzing with phrases like "Sativa," "Indica," and "combinations". But what do these categories really mean? Are they strict classifications, or is there more complexity to the story?

Traditionally, Indica strains were grouped based on physical characteristics like plant height. Sativas, known for their tall and slender plants, were often associated with uplifting effects, while Indicas, typically shorter and bushier, were connected to more calming experiences.
